uniapp 直接调用methods内方法的返回值
时间: 2023-05-24 18:02:46 浏览: 1012
A:在uniapp中,可以直接调用methods内方法的返回值。方法的返回值可以直接在template中使用{{}}来展示,也可以在methods内其他方法中使用。例如:
``` vue
<template>
<div>
<p>{{ greet }}</p>
<button @click="sayHello()">Say Hello</button>
</div>
</template>
<script>
export default {
data() {
return {
name: 'ChitGPT',
};
},
methods: {
getGreeting() {
return `Hello, ${this.name}!`;
},
sayHello() {
const greeting = this.getGreeting();
console.log(greeting);
alert(greeting);
},
},
computed: {
greet() {
return this.getGreeting();
},
},
};
</script>
```
在上面的例子中,`getGreeting()`方法返回一个字符串,可以直接在template中使用`{{greet}}`来展示。另外,在`sayHello()`方法内部也可以直接使用`this.getGreeting()`来获取返回值。
相关推荐
![pdf](https://img-home.csdnimg.cn/images/20210720083512.png)
![pdf](https://img-home.csdnimg.cn/images/20210720083512.png)
![pdf](https://img-home.csdnimg.cn/images/20210720083512.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)